Market Ecosystem and Operational Framework Key Product Categories L-Glutamic Acid L-Lysine L-Threonine L-Tryptophan Other amino acids (e.g., L-Methionine, L-Phenylalanine) Stakeholders and Demand-Supply Framework The ecosystem comprises raw material suppliers (e.g., fermentation substrates, petrochemical derivatives), amino acid producers (both domestic and multinational corporations), distributors, and end-users spanning food, pharma, cosmetics, and animal feed sectors. The supply chain operates on a just-in-time basis, with strategic inventory management critical to mitigate raw material price volatility and regulatory delays. Value Chain Dynamics Raw Material Sourcing: Includes fermentation substrates (corn, sugarcane), petrochemical derivatives, and specialty chemicals. Raw material costs account for approximately 40-50% of total production expenses. Manufacturing: Encompasses fermentation, enzymatic conversion, purification, and formulation. South Korea hosts several integrated facilities leveraging advanced bioreactor technologies, with CAPEX investments averaging USD 50-100 million per plant. Distribution: Combines direct sales, regional distributors, and e-commerce platforms. Logistics are optimized via digital tracking, with regional hubs facilitating rapid delivery to domestic and export markets. End-User Delivery & Lifecycle Services: Includes technical support, quality assurance, regulatory compliance assistance, and R&D collaborations. Revenue models are primarily based on product sales, licensing, and contract manufacturing. Adoption Trends and End-User Segments Food & Beverage High adoption of amino acids as flavor enhancers and nutritional fortifiers. Functional foods infused with amino acids are gaining popularity among health-conscious consumers, especially in sports nutrition and weight management segments. Pharmaceuticals Use in injectable formulations, amino acid-based therapeutics, and nutraceuticals. Growing demand driven by aging populations and chronic disease management. Cosmetics & Personal Care Incorporation into anti-aging creams, moisturizers, and hair care products, leveraging amino acids’ moisturizing and skin-repairing properties. Animal Nutrition Increased use as feed additives to improve growth rates and feed efficiency, aligned with sustainable livestock practices. Competitive Landscape Key global players include Ajinomoto Co., Inc., Evonik Industries AG, and Archer Daniels Midland Company, focusing on innovation, strategic partnerships, and capacity expansion. Regional players such as Daesang Corporation and CJ CheilJedang are emphasizing vertical integration and sustainability initiatives. Segmental Analysis Product Type: L-Glutamic Acid and L-Lysine dominate, but specialty amino acids like L-Arginine and L-Ornithine are emerging niches. Technology: Fermentation remains dominant, with enzymatic synthesis gaining traction for high-purity applications. Application: Food & beverage leads, followed by pharmaceuticals and animal nutrition, with cosmetics showing rapid growth.
